"Survivor: Heroes vs. Villains" won't premiere on CBS until February 11, but as with every season you can expect a profile of each contestant here leading up to the 20th edition of the popular reality competition.
Today, the focus is on Russell Hantz.
Name: Russell Hantz
Age: 37
Occupation: Oil company owner
Location: Dayton, Texas
Past seasons: "Survivor: Samoa"
Tribe: Villains
Claim to fame: CBS has been quick to label Russell as the "greatest villain in 'Survivor' history," and they wouldn't be altogether wrong. Last season Russell lied, manipulated, and schemed his way through the game. He was smart enough to find hidden immunity idols, and he used one of them to save both himself and the entire Foa Foa tribe. Russell may also be just as famous, though, for losing to Natalie after the jury didn't feel like he played a good enough "social game" for the prize. (Ask Russell, and he'll say they were bitter.)
Is he an All-Star? Without a doubt. Hats off to Russell for agreeing to go another grueling season just 14 days after he finished filming the first one. He's the kind of player that we've only seen a few times before on "Survivor," and he probably does a better at job at being evil than any of them. It also helps that he's obnoxious, cocky, and entertaining to watch.
Analysis: Russell has both a major advantage and disadvantage going into this game. Since they filmed "Heroes vs. Villains" before "Samoa" aired, nobody is going to know exactly what this guy did to earn his "villain" title. He can use that to his advantage and hide behind some of the other schemers (like Boston Rob) early on. On the other hand, Russell also didn't have a chance to watch himself on TV. Like Amanda Kimmel going into "Fans vs. Favorites," he may not have had enough time to analyze where he went wrong the first time around.
Prediction: With that in mind, I actually expect Russell to do exactly what he did in "Samoa:" he'll dominate much of the game before fizzling out in the end. the guy just doesn't realize that some people can't separate their emotions from the game! The people may be "bitter," but he needs to find a way to account for that. He'll probably try to take two "weaker" players to the end and wind up either being taken out before the final tribal council or losing it at the very end.
